Overview

In this course, you’ll review what ethics means for a CPA firm and how to use the rules. The interactive workshop is designed for practitioners in small and medium-sized CPA firms and includes generous time for questions and case studies.

    Objectives

    • Understand the AICPA Code of Professional Conduct
    • Recognize the interplay between the code and Quality Management of a CPA firm
    • Analyze ethical dilemmas for CPAs, including prohibited transactions, independence rules, conflicts of interest, professional responsibility, the subordination of judgment, and confidentiality and disclosure in engagement letters
    • Analyze threats and safeguards in the firm
